控制台

网站是HTTP?10分钟变成HTTPS!域名免费添加配置SSL证书,变成https//环境

心不动则不痛 提交于 2019-12-02 02:08:04
  对于小程序request请求需要https域名、navigator.geolocation定位也需要在https环境下才可以生效等问题; 前端开发越来越需要https环境来来测试一下API接口和各类问题,今天来讲解一下怎么免费快速把普通的http网站配置升级成https协议。 首先向大家介绍一下HTTP和HTTPS的基本概念:    HTTP:是互联网上应用最为广泛的一种网络协议,是一个客户端和服务器端请求和应答的标准(TCP),可以使浏览器更加高效,使网络传输减少。    HTTPS:是以安全为目标的HTTP通道,简单讲是HTTP的安全版,即HTTP下加入SSL层,HTTPS的安全基础是SSL,因此加密的详细内容就需要SSL。 1.在此之前一定要申请一个http的域名,先申请个免费的SSL证书,我申请阿里云的免费SSL     阿里云免费SLL申请网站:( https://common-buy.aliyun.com/?spm=5176.7968328.1266638..5e971232StYwxz&commodityCode=cas&aly_as=RhwKyAvA#/buy ) 2.免费购买之后,进入SSL证书管理控制台,找到刚才购买好的证书,点击证书申请,绑定自身的域名,填写相关联系信息,证书之类的设置就默认选项就OK,大概半个小时,会提示证书申请成功。 3.申请签发成功后

win10下安装anaconda3+python3.7+tensorflow2.0.0(GPU)+cuda10.0+cudnn+pytorch及查看cuda+cudnn版本

帅比萌擦擦* 提交于 2019-12-02 01:34:38
1.安装anaconda Anaconda 官网下载地址: https://www.continuum.io/downloads 下载后双击安装包一路下载即可。可选择安装路径,记得一定要点√添加路径。 验证:之后看菜单中是否有anaconda3 2.Cuda+cuDNN+tensorflow-gpu 之前安装需要查TensorFlow版本与cuda适配rutensorflow 1.5.0支持cuda9.0,cuda9.0对应的cuDNN等等。 ①现在点击anadconda中Anaconda Prompt,进入到一个控制台后 ②创建一个虚拟环境.tensorflow2.0_gpu:虚拟环境名字,python=3.7:搭建虚拟环境是用python3.7这个版本建立的 在命令行中输入: conda create -n tensorflow2.0_gpu python=3.7 ③激活环境 在命令行中输入: conda activate tensorflow2.0_gpu ④安装TensorFlow2.0 可以在图中看到,在这一步anaconda就直接给我们安装好了cuda和cudnn,非常的方便。 在命令行中输入: pip install tensorflow-gpu==2.0.0-alpha0 pip install --upgrade --pre tensorflow -i https

从控制台录入一个字符串,判断'a'在该字符串中出现的次数

巧了我就是萌 提交于 2019-12-02 00:26:10
public class TestB { public static void main(String[] args) { String s="abaajncxba 5486758s49a67 a%a$aaaaTYH^J&a%^an y8937yutqaaa4i5ytgu5aaa4ty35yt"; //普通方法 int sumTest=0; for(int j=0;j<=s.length()-1;j++) { if(s.charAt(j)=='a') sumTest++; } System.out.println("事实上a共出现了"+sumTest+"次"); //更快一点的方法 String[] str=s.split("a"); String sum=""; for(String i:str) { sum=sum+i; } int len=sum.length(); System.out.println("用效率高的方法算得a共出现"+(s.length()-len)+"次"); } } 输出: 事实上a共出现了19次 用效率a共出现19次 来源: CSDN 作者: 蒟蒻666 链接: https://blog.csdn.net/weixin_42594318/article/details/81348271

Spring Cloud Alibaba学习笔记(5) - 整合Sentinel及Sentinel规则

北慕城南 提交于 2019-12-01 23:49:06
整合Sentinel 应用整合Sentinel 在dependencies中添加依赖,即可整合Sentinel <dependency> <groupId>com.alibaba.cloud</groupId> <artifactId>spring-cloud-starter-alibaba-sentinel</artifactId> </dependency> 搭建Sentinel控制台 可以从这个地址:https://github.com/alibaba/Sentinel/releases 下载控制台应用。因为下载速度较慢,给出一个我下载的版本(1.6.3) 百度云地址:链接: https://pan.baidu.com/s/1UV4OzfjfuBZQfpPb28z0sw&shfl=sharepset 密码: i68g 运行命令启动控制台: java -jar sentinel-dashboard-1.6.3.jar 打开浏览器,输入http://localhost:8080进入控制台页面(账号密码默认sentinel) 应用整合Sentinel控制台 添加配置文件: spring: cloud: sentinel: transport: # 指定sentinel控制台地址 dashboard: localhost:8080 PS: 其他的配置项 spring: cloud:

Ruby Rails学习中:

佐手、 提交于 2019-12-01 23:45:15
用户建模 一. User 模型 实现用户注册功能的第一步是,创建一个数据结构,用于存取用户的信息。 在 Rails 中,数据模型的默认数据结构叫模型(model,MVC 中的 M)。Rails 为解决数据持久化提供的默认解决方案是,使用数据库存储需要长期使用的数据。与数据库交互默认使用的是 ActiveRecord。Active Record 提供了一系列方法,无需使用关系数据库所用的结构化查询语言(Structured QueryLanguage,简称 SQL),就能创建、保存和查询数据对象。Rails 还支持迁移(migration)功能,允许我们使用纯 Ruby 代码定义数据结构,而不用学习 SQL 数据定义语言(Data Definition Language,简称 DDL)。最终的结果是,Active Record 把你和数据库完全隔开了。咱们开发的应用在本地使用 SQLite,部署后使用PostgreSQL。这就引出了一个更深层的话题——在不同的环境中,即便使用不同类型的数据库,我们也无需关心 Rails 是如何存储数据的。 1.数据库迁移 回顾一下前面的内容, 我们在自己创建的 User 类中为用户对象定义了 name 和 email 两个属性。那是个很有用的例子, 但没有实现持久化存储最关键的要求: 在 Rails 控制台中创建的用户对象, 退出控制台后就会消失

如何从网页中控制台获取到源码位置

丶灬走出姿态 提交于 2019-12-01 22:55:10
各位大佬,求指教, 在vue项目中,引用了某个框架,框架中有很多自定义的标签,和默认样式,在经过浏览器解析后,这些自定义的标签就会显示出默认的样式,并且解析成div+css基础结构。在控制台中可以看到这样的代码 而源码中并不是这样写的,怎么才能通过控制台找到对应的源码或模块??? 在此先谢谢了,我需要通过控制台找到源码或者模块在哪 来源: https://www.cnblogs.com/jickma/p/11719910.html

JavaScript学习笔记

↘锁芯ラ 提交于 2019-12-01 21:51:55
JS基础 基本类型和对象 String 要想让字符串里嵌套引号,有两个方法。 字符串用单引号引起来,字符串内的引号用双引号; 1 var str = '我说:"今晚月色很好"'; 2 console.log(str);   控制台显示:      2. 字符串内的引号用转义字符 \ 表示。 var str = "我说:\"今晚月色很好\""; console.log(str);   控制台显示:    两种方法效果一样。 Null 定义一个变量的值为null,对变量用typeof进行检测,其显示结果为object。 示例: 1 var a = null; 2 console.log(a); 3 console.log(typeof a); 控制台显示: 类型转换 其它转换为number 转换方式一:使用Number()函数 String→number   (1). 如果是纯数字的字符串,则直接将其转换为数字;   (2). 如果字符串中有非数字的内容,则转换为NaN;   示例: 1 var a = "abc"; 2 a = Number(a); 3 console.log(a); 4 console.log(typeof a);   控制台显示:      (3). 如果字符串是一个空串或者是一个全是空格的字符串,则转换为0。   2. Boolean→number   (1).

蓝奏网盘CMD控制台

情到浓时终转凉″ 提交于 2019-12-01 21:35:14
LanZouCloud-CMD 2.0 基于蓝奏云API开发的CMD版蓝奏云控制台 Github : https://github.com/zaxtyson/LanZouCloud-CMD 更新说明 修复了登录 formhash 的错误 增加了上传/下载的进度条 #1 使用 RAR 分卷压缩代替文件分段 #2 修复了连续上传大文件被ban的问题 #3 增加了回收站功能 取消了 种子文件 下载方式,自动识别分卷数据并解压 增加了通过分享链接下载的功能 下载使用 蓝奏云网盘下载 Windows版 在本项目的 releases 板块下载 其它说明 为了方便管理,API独立为一个项目 LanZouCloud-API 在 Linux 平台使用时,您需要安装 rar 工具,然后在 config.ini 中设置它的路径 默认下载路径为 D:\LanZouCloud ,请使用 setpath 命令修改 可以使用 down 分享链接 的方式下载文件(夹)了~ 关注本页面以获取更新,如果有问题或者建议,请提 issue 如果喜欢本项目,请给一个 star (^▽^)/ 命令帮助 help 显示帮助信息 login 登录网盘/切换账号 logout 注销当前账号 ls 列出文件(夹) cd 切换工作目录 cdrec 进入回收站 rm 删除网盘文件(夹) mkdir 创建新文件夹 share 显示分享信息

扛住阿里双十一高并发流量,Sentinel是怎么做到的?

有些话、适合烂在心里 提交于 2019-12-01 19:54:33
Sentinel 承接了阿里巴巴近 10 年的双十一大促流量的核心场景 本文介绍阿里开源限流熔断方案 Sentinel 功能、原理、架构、快速入门以及相关框架比较 基本介绍 1 名词解释 服务限流 :当系统资源不够,不足以应对大量请求,对系统按照预设的规则进行流量限制或功能限制 服务熔断 :当调用目标服务的请求和调用大量超时或失败,服务调用方为避免造成长时间的阻塞造成影响其他服务,后续对该服务接口的调用不再经过进行请求,直接执行本地的默认方法 服务降级 :为了保证核心业务在大量请求下能正常运行,根据实际业务情况及流量,对部分服务降低优先级,有策略的不处理或用简单的方式处理 服务降级的实现可以基于人工开关降级(秒杀、电商大促等)和自动检测(超时、失败次数、故障),熔断可以理解为一种服务故障降级处理 2 为什么需要限流降级 系统承载的访问量是有限的,如果不做流量控制,会导致系统资源占满,服务超时,从而所有用户无法使用,通过服务限流控制请求的量,服务降级省掉非核心业务对系统资源的占用,最大化利用系统资源,尽可能服务更多用户 3 Sentinel 简介 Sentinel: 分布式系统的流量防卫兵,是阿里中间件团队 2018 年 7 月开源的,面向分布式服务架构的轻量级流量控制产品,主要以流量为切入点,从流量控制、熔断降级、系统负载保护等多个维度来保护系统服务的稳定性 Sentinel

探索 Eclipse 的 OSGi 控制台

霸气de小男生 提交于 2019-12-01 19:13:05
从 V3.0 开始,Eclipse 通过选择开放服务网关协议(Open Services Gateway Initiative,OSGi)来替换先前版本中不稳定的 Eclipse 插件技术,从而实现了一次巨大飞跃。这次转变对于用户来说几乎是透明的,因为现在所使用的插件的安装和操作看上去和以前的插件没有什么不同。 图 1. Eclipse 内的插件 由 于 Eclipse 现在是在 OSGi 上构建的,因此我们在图 1 中看到的插件是功能完整的 OSGi 包。(图 2 显示了使用 OSGi 控制台运行 Eclipse 实例内的包。)通过使用 OSGi,Eclipse 支持业内认可的开放标准并且现在可以利用 OSGi 提供的功能,包括安全性、HTTP 服务、用户管理和其他功能。Eclipse 对 OSGi 的使用已经见到成效,因为我们看到插件间报告的冲突在减少而 Eclipse 的应用在持续增加。 图 2. Eclipse 内的 OSGi 包 Eclipse、Equinox、OSGi,天哪! OSGi Alliance 是一个独立的、非盈利性组织,负责 OSGi 技术,类似于 Eclipse Foundation 的职能。OSGi Alliance 负责制定描述 OSGi 技术的规范。简言之,OSGI 技术为应用程序开发提供了一种面向服务的基于组件的平台。各种实现都是基于这些规范的